Regional scorecards (experimental)

How has each of the 14 grid regions in Great Britain generated electricity since the start of the year. Which are low carbon regions and which are high carbon?

Data for year to date: 1 January – 17 Jun 2026
GB average carbon intensity: 119 gCO2/kWh · moderate · Wind 36.9% · Solar 5.8%
